Postal Card #5 [1920 Zone 1 (With Overprint) 10 pf] USED, WITH A DANISH STAMP, AFTER VALIDITY OF THE CARD, BUT FROM A TOWN THAT WAS IN THE PLEBISCITE AREA. Denmark Scott #102 [1913 15 øre violet Christian X] (F-VF) placed on top of the Slesvig indicia -- but offset enough to clearly understand the overprinted indicia underneath -- and used on 30 March 1921 from KLIPLEV, a small village in the Aabenraa municipality, located in what was Zone 1 during the plebiscite; to Viborg. The postal validity of the Zone 1 stamps and postal cards ended 15 July 1920, thus this sender used a Danish stamp to mail the card. A completely proper and legitimate business correspondence use. (This card would be quite scarce if it had been used in the plebiscite period of validity.) Very interesting and attractive.
